1. Whitepaper Overview: High-Performance Steel Windows in Seoul’s Built Environment
The Seoul Metropolitan Area represents one of Asia’s most demanding architectural landscapes. Characterized by high urban density, strict municipal energy codes, dramatic seasonal temperature swings (ranging from -15°C during Siberian winter gusts to +35°C during humid summer monsoons), and high acoustic pressure, building envelope specifications leave no room for compromise. As South Korea accelerates its transition toward Net-Zero Buildings under the revised Green Building Construction Support Act, local developers, general contractors, and facade engineers in Seoul are increasingly turning to top-tier Chinese steel window manufacturers to deliver world-class fenestration systems.
Historically, traditional steel windows were criticized for poor thermal performance despite their unmatched structural strength and slender aesthetic profiles. However, the modern generation of Thermal Break Cold-Rolled Steel Profile Windows manufactured in China’s advanced precision fabrication hubs has completely redefined this product category. By incorporating high-density PA66 nylon thermal barriers, multi-chambered air seals, and high-performance Low-E triple glazing, leading Chinese suppliers now offer steel windows that surpass South Korea's strict KS F 2278 insulation standards while retaining the ultra-narrow sightlines that top Korean architects demand.

2. Engineering Performance Matrix: Steel vs. Aluminum vs. UPVC
When selecting window systems for commercial developments or high-value residential projects across Seoul, structural engineering data guides specification decisions. Below is a comparative performance matrix based on laboratory testing under ISO 10077 and South Korean KS testing frameworks:
| Performance Metrics | Cold-Rolled Thermal Steel | Thermal Break Aluminum | High-Density UPVC Frame |
|---|---|---|---|
| Structural Tensile Strength | 400 – 550 MPa (Highest) | 160 – 220 MPa (Moderate) | 40 – 60 MPa (Low) |
| Visible Frame Sightline | 25 mm – 45 mm (Ultra-Slim) | 55 mm – 90 mm (Standard) | 80 mm – 120 mm (Bulky) |
| Thermal Transmittance (U-Factor) | 0.8 – 1.2 W/m²K | 1.1 – 1.5 W/m²K | 1.2 – 1.6 W/m²K |
| Wind Pressure Capacity | Up to 5,500 Pa (Typhoon Grade) | 3,000 – 4,000 Pa | 1,800 – 2,500 Pa |
| Acoustic Insulation (STC/Rw) | 42 – 48 dB Sound Block | 35 – 40 dB | 32 – 36 dB |
| Fire Rating / Incombustibility | Class A Non-Combustible | Melts at High Temp | Combustible / Toxic Fumes |
As demonstrated in the matrix above, precision cold-rolled thermal steel frames offer three times the structural strength of aluminum, enabling massive floor-to-ceiling glass expanses without bulky intermediate reinforcement bars. This is a crucial design requirement for multi-story penthouse projects in Gangnam and Songpa-gu.

4. South Korea Market Trends & Regulatory Compliance Pathways
To successfully supply window systems into the Seoul market, manufacturers must navigate strict local regulatory frameworks and keep pace with evolving consumer preferences. Key market drivers include:
1. Mandatory Zero Energy Building (ZEB) Certification
Starting in 2024, South Korea extended mandatory ZEB requirements to private residential buildings with over 30 units. Windows are a primary vector for thermal gain and loss. Chinese suppliers catering to Seoul provide advanced thermal break profiles filled with polyurethane foam, warm-edge spacers, and double-pass Argon gas injection to achieve zero-energy compliance effortlessly.
2. KS Certification & Testing Protocols (KS F 2278 / KS F 2292)
Before installation on any tier-1 general contractor site (such as Hyundai E&C, GS E&C, or Samsung C&T), window mockups must undergo stringent air permeability, water tightness, and thermal resistance testing. Premier Chinese manufacturers maintain in-house CNAS-accredited testing labs and partner with international certification bodies to deliver fully pre-tested products ready for local Korean laboratory validation.
3. Urban Noise Abatement Policies
With Seoul’s densely packed urban expressways (such as the Olympic Boulevard and Gangbyeon Expressway), soundproofing is a mandatory luxury. Dual-seal EPDM weatherstripping coupled with asymmetric laminated glass units (e.g., 6mm + 1.52PVB + 6mm outer pane with a 16mm argon gap and 8mm inner pane) effectively dampens low-frequency traffic rumble.
